How much does biohazard cleaning cost in Tilbury?

Every job in Tilbury is priced on assessment and confirmed in writing before any work starts, and the assessment itself is free. As a general UK guide, most biohazard and trauma cleans fall between roughly £500 and £3,000, though smaller jobs like sharps removal start lower, and much of this work is claimable on insurance.

Type of jobTypical guide rangeWhat affects it
Blood or bodily-fluid cleanup£600 to £1,500Contained area, one room
Trauma / crime scene cleaning£800 to £3,000+Depends on spread and materials affected
Unattended death decontaminationfrom ~£1,000Higher where decomposition or odour is advanced
Hoarding clean-up£500 to £5,000+Driven by volume and biohazard content
Sewage / category-three flood£700 to £4,000+Depends on area, drying and strip-out
Sharps & needle removalfrom ~£150Per visit; larger sites quoted on assessment

General UK guide ranges as of 2026; every job in Tilbury is quoted on assessment and confirmed in writing first. See the full cost guide →

Step by step

How the clean-up works

The same careful process on every job, whatever has happened and wherever in Tilbury it is.

  1. 1

    Assess

    We attend, assess the property and the contamination, and agree a written price before any work begins. The assessment is free.

  2. 2

    Contain

    We isolate the affected area so nothing spreads to clean parts of the property, and set up the right protective controls.

  3. 3

    Remove

    Contaminated materials that cannot be salvaged are removed and bagged for disposal through a licensed clinical-waste carrier.

  4. 4

    Clean & disinfect

    Every affected surface is cleaned and treated with hospital-grade disinfectant to a verifiable standard.

  5. 5

    Deodorise

    We treat lingering odour at source rather than masking it, so the property does not smell of what happened.

  6. 6

    Verify & hand over

    We check the result, confirm the area is safe to use again, and provide documentation for landlords or insurers where needed.

Questions people in Tilbury ask

Do I need to call the council or the police first?

If a crime or a sudden death is involved, the police attend first and will release the property when they are done; we work after that. For anything else you can call us directly, and if you are unsure we will tell you the right order to do things.

Will anyone know what has happened?

No. We arrive in an unmarked van, in plain clothing, and work discreetly. Nothing on the vehicle or our approach identifies the nature of the job to neighbours in Tilbury.

Is biohazard cleaning in Tilbury covered by insurance?

Often, yes. Trauma, crime scene and unattended-death cleaning is frequently covered by home, contents or landlord insurance. We can quote for the claim and deal with your insurer directly so you do not have to.
